
Frogs Earn Pair of Victories in Virginia
2/8/2019 9:54:00 PM | Equestrian
Henningsen wins stays perfect, wins two MOPs
SWEET BRIAR, Va. – In its first regular-season contests since November, the No. 6 TCU equestrian team took down Sweet Briar, 8-2, Friday morning before turning around and picking up a 7-1 win over Lynchburg at the Harriett Howell Rogers Riding Center in Sweet Briar, Va.
TCU continued to show strong individually, earning all four Most Outstanding Performer honors awarded on the day.

The Rundown
The Horned Frogs kicked off the day with a 4-1 victory over Sweet Briar in Equitation over Fences. Wynne Weatherly, Izzy Baxter, and Raegan Rast all scored over 80, earning scores of 80, 82 and 80, respectively. It was Alex Beneson, however, who picked up her first MOP on the season, winning 79-71 on Aate.
TCU finished its meet with Sweet Briar winning 4-1 in Equitation on the Flat. Janelle Henningsen scored the highest in the event with a 65, good enough to win the MOP. Freshman Wynne Weatherly earned the biggest victory of the event, winning 62-54 on Jakson.
The Frogs then turned their attention to Lynchburg in the second meet of the day and started with Equitation on the Flat, where they swept the Hornets. Janelle Henningsen claimed her second MOP honor of the day, winning 58-48 on Ozzie. Alex Beneson put together a strong showing on the Flat winning 60-0.
In Equitation over Fences, TCU was victorious, 3-1. In the three points the Frogs earned, they scored over 78 in each one. Jacey Albaugh earned her second career MOP with a 78-74 win. Grace Upshaw was the high-scorer of the event earning a 80.
Notes
- Janelle Henningsen remained undefeated on the season at 5-0-2, she also earned her first and second MOPs of the season.
- The Frogs earned a sweep in Equitation on the Flat for the fourth time this season.
- TCU has now earned 23 of the 28 MOP honors awarded this season.
-The average score for TCU in Equitation on the Flat was 58.3, but that did not stop TCU from earning nine points in the event.
